The length of a rectangle with an area of 1024cm squared. Work out the width of the rectangle

Respuesta :

altavistard
altavistard altavistard
  • 25-10-2018

Answer:

W = 1024 cm^2 / L

Step-by-step explanation:

rectangle area is equal to the length times the width, or A = LW.

Solving for W, we get W = A/L

Here, W = 1024 cm^2 / L is the formula you need to determine W when L is given.
